I started my watercolour journey with pans like these, probably a 12 colour set for about $25nzd, and for the longest time i thought i couldnt paint! They would dry so chalky and wouldnt move nicely. After my mother died i had a bit of money and was sad so decided to try a WN palette. At about $120nzd it was a JUMP but i was seriously joy seeking! Suddenly my pictures weren't demoralizingly awful! It was a starter palette so i could mix almost anything i needed (eventually invested in a CMY flavoured palette with some umber and sienna and then REALLY could make whatever i wanted. I guess thats what a printing background does to you.) It felt nice to paint, used less paint, and the results actually allowed me to see that i was improving. I think perhaps its easier to work with the cheaper paints once you have worked with more expensive ones so you know how the colours should work. I wish access to quality art supplies was easier for everyone. The benefits to mental health are immeasurable.

@RebelUnicornCrafts5 ай бұрын
I don’t recall if I’ve played with that particular palette, but I do vary the ‘level’ of my paints in my palette and when I’m mixing colors. I wouldn’t mix a super budget palette like crayola colors with my QoR colors, for example, but I’ve had some great success with the Michael’s store brand (Artist’s loft) color tubes. Some of the midrange colors have more variety in quality between colors, but if you like a color and it works well for you, I’d absolutely use it.
